Book Synopsis Spiritual Defiance by : Robin Rex Meyers

Download or read book Spiritual Defiance written by Robin Rex Meyers and published by Yale University Press. This book was released on 2015-01-01 with total page 167 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Calls readers to reinvigorate the church by returning it to its roots as a community of resistance, against the dominant culture, egoism, and forces that threaten human life and dignity.
